B1.3.1.2 Task of Replacing YFGW710

Replace YFGW710 following the steps below.
1. Task of setting YFGW710 (in section B1.2.3.1 of this document)
2. Installing YFGW710 at the plant site
3. Task of downloading to YFGW710 (in section B1.2.4.2 of this document)
4. Task of checking the field wireless network operation conditions (in section B1.2.5 of this

document)

5. Checking process data communication (in section B1.2.7 of this document)

l

Notes

▪ When downloading to YFGW710, the task of “Registering Provisioning Information with the

Project Database” in section B1.2.4.1 of this document does not need to be performed.

▪ Ensure that the power supply of the existing YFGW710 to be replaced is turned off before

performing the replacement task. If the existing YFGW710 to be replaced is running, radio

signals of the new YFGW710 and the existing YFGW710 to be replaced interfere with each

other and the replacement task cannot be performed correctly.

▪ When downloading to the new YFGW710 is completed, YFGW710 restarts. It may take

about 30 minutes until all the field wireless devices have joined the field wireless network.

▪ Since a field wireless device that has joined the field wireless network automatically starts

process data communication, the task of “Downloading the Process Data Communication

Definitions” in section B1.2.7 of this document does not need to be performed.

▪ To check whether or not process data communication has started correctly, it is recommend-

ed to perform the checking task described in “■ Checking Process Data Communication” of

“Task of downloading the Process Data Communication Definitions” in section B1.2.7 of this

document. During the time until process data communication has started correctly, IOP is

displayed in HMI of Yokogawa’s control system.
